Warning Signs You Need Drywall Water Damage Repair
Don’t wait until it’s too late – water damage can spread quickly, causing thousands of dollars in damage to your home. Catch these warning signs early to prevent bigger problems:
Droopy Ceilings
Water damage can cause ceilings to sag or droop, especially if it’s been accumulating over time. If you notice this, it’s time to call us – we’ll assess and repair the damage quickly.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Those pesky musty smells can be a sign of water damage or mold growth. Don’t ignore it – call us for a thorough inspection and repair.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ls
Discoloration or water stains on your walls or ceiling are clear indicators of water damage. Don’t wait – call us to assess and repair the damage.
Water-Soaked Insulation
Water-soaked insulation can lead to costly repairs down the line. We’ll extract the damaged insulation and replace it with new, to prevent further issues.
Warped or Buckled Drywall
Warped or buckled drywall is a clear sign of water damage. We’ll repair or replace the affected area to ensure a seamless finish.
Water Damage to Electrical Outlets or Switches
Water damage to electrical parts can be a serious safety hazard. We’ll assess and repair the damage to prevent further issues.
Drywall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ak with minimal damage | Yes | Maybe | DIY can be fine for small leaks, but be sure to contain the water and call a pro if it’s not contained quickly. |
| Burst pipe with significant damage | No | Yes | For larger water damage, it’s best to call a professional to prevent further issues and ensure a proper repair. |
| Water-soaked insulation | No | Yes | Water-soaked insulation can lead to costly repairs down the line – let a pro handle it. |
| Warped or buckled drywall | No | Yes | A professional will ensure a seamless finish and prevent further issues. |
